Output 266283d8ae029a9c135df242d67a6a71ed1b903b1d16ffde89f0808868a1830b:1

value
3307400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8dd66394efe7edadd96c91ef43c9483aeadb028 OP_EQUALVERIFY OP_CHECKSIG
address
1HrUZPfEZJ2hNa2tTdDhuERCxbBCkxwaXG
transaction
266283d8ae029a9c135df242d67a6a71ed1b903b1d16ffde89f0808868a1830b